## Top Medical Billing & Coding Jobs in Orlando, FL
In Orlando’s vibrant healthcare market, numerous job opportunities are available for certified professionals.Below are some of the leading roles in medical billing and coding, along with typical responsibilities and salary expectations.
###
1. Medical Biller
*Responsibilities:*
– Preparing and submitting insurance claims
– Managing patient billing inquiries
– verifying insurance coverage
– Ensuring timely payments
*Salary Range:* $35,000 – $55,000 annually
###
2. Medical Coder
*Responsibilities:*
– Assigning accurate billing codes to diagnoses and procedures
- Ensuring compliance with coding standards
– reviewing medical records for accuracy
*Salary Range:* $40,000 – $60,000 annually
###
3. Medical Office Billing & Coding Specialist
*Responsibilities:*
– Handling both billing and coding tasks
– Managing patient accounts
– Coordinating with insurance companies
*Salary Range:* $38,000 – $58,000 annually
###
4. Revenue Cycle Manager
*Responsibilities:*
– Overseeing the entire billing and coding process
– Enhancing revenue flow
– training staff
*Salary Range:* $60,000 – $85,000 annually
###
5. Clinical Data Analyst
*Responsibilities:*
– Analyzing coding and billing data
– Improving coding accuracy
– Ensuring compliance with healthcare regulations
*Salary Range:* $55,000 – $75,000 annually

## The Job Market in Orlando, FL
###
Current Industry Trends
Orlando’s healthcare sector is expanding rapidly with new hospitals, clinics, and outpatient centers. The city hosts major healthcare providers, including AdventHealth Orlando, orlando Health, and Nemours Children’s Hospital, all of which have significant billing and coding departments.
This growth translates into numerous job opportunities, especially for certified professionals with relevant experience and certifications like the certified Professional Coder (CPC) or certified Coding Specialist (CCS).

## Practical tips to Launch Your Healthcare Career in Orlando
###
1. Obtain Relevant Certification
Certifications substantially improve employability and earning potential. Consider certifications like:
– Certified Professional Coder (CPC)
– Certified Coding Specialist (CCS)
– Certified Medical Reimbursement Specialist (CMRS)
###
2. Pursue Quality Training Programs
Many community colleges and online institutions in Orlando offer accredited medical billing and coding training programs. Look for programs that include hands-on internship opportunities.###
3.Gain practical Experience
Internships, volunteer roles, or part-time positions help build confidence and a professional network within Orlando’s healthcare industry.###
4. Network Actively
Join local healthcare associations like the Florida Medical Billing & Coding Association or attend industry seminars to connect with potential employers.
###
5. Keep Up with industry Changes
Stay updated on healthcare coding standard updates (ICD, CPT, HCPCS codes) and legislative changes affecting billing practices.
